運(yùn)籌學(xué)論文產(chǎn)銷不平衡運(yùn)輸問題.doc_第1頁
運(yùn)籌學(xué)論文產(chǎn)銷不平衡運(yùn)輸問題.doc_第2頁
運(yùn)籌學(xué)論文產(chǎn)銷不平衡運(yùn)輸問題.doc_第3頁
運(yùn)籌學(xué)論文產(chǎn)銷不平衡運(yùn)輸問題.doc_第4頁
運(yùn)籌學(xué)論文產(chǎn)銷不平衡運(yùn)輸問題.doc_第5頁
已閱讀5頁,還剩4頁未讀, 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報或認(rèn)領(lǐng)

文檔簡介

1、重慶文理學(xué)院 數(shù)學(xué)與財經(jīng) 統(tǒng)計學(xué) 石艷泓 qq:593982714 電話理運(yùn)籌學(xué)論文 -產(chǎn)銷不平衡運(yùn)輸問題姓名:石艷泓 學(xué)號:201002054030 班級:10級統(tǒng)計摘要:運(yùn)輸問題是運(yùn)籌學(xué)中的一個重要問題,也是物流系統(tǒng)優(yōu)化中常見的問題,同時也是一種特殊的線性規(guī)劃問題。怎么樣盡可能的在產(chǎn)地與銷地之間減少運(yùn)輸成本和降低運(yùn)輸費(fèi)用是很多運(yùn)輸公司熱切關(guān)注的話題。本文涉及的是一個總產(chǎn)量大于總銷量的產(chǎn)銷不平衡運(yùn)輸問題,通過對產(chǎn)地與銷售地車輛運(yùn)輸?shù)慕⒛P停谶\(yùn)用表上作業(yè)迭代法(最小元素法)求解后,再根據(jù)模型用lingo軟件編寫程序進(jìn)行求解。然后對結(jié)果進(jìn)行分析,以及運(yùn)輸問題的延伸。

2、最后證明用lingo解決車輛運(yùn)輸?shù)目尚行浴jP(guān)鍵字:運(yùn)輸問題,產(chǎn)銷不平衡,表上作業(yè)法, lingo模型問題提出:重慶有三家電子廠分別是新普,隆宇和恒華,生產(chǎn)的筆記本電腦將要運(yùn)向北京,天津,廣東,上海四個城市銷售,其產(chǎn)量和銷售量見下表:(單位:萬臺)表:1-1北京天津廣東上海產(chǎn)量新普626730隆宇495325恒華881521銷量15172212-問:哪種銷售方案將會取得最少的運(yùn)輸費(fèi)用,費(fèi)用為多少?問題分析:圖表數(shù)據(jù)顯示產(chǎn)量總和為30+25+21=76萬臺,銷量的總和為15+17+22+12=66萬臺,說明了此問題是一個總產(chǎn)量大于總銷量的運(yùn)輸問題(7666)。該問題一方面要求滿足北京,天津,廣東,

3、上海四個銷售地的供貨需求,而另一方面又要考慮新普,隆宇和恒華三個產(chǎn)地的運(yùn)往銷售地的運(yùn)輸費(fèi)用,此外問題不但要求滿足銷售地分配要足,同時也要保證最大化的減少運(yùn)輸費(fèi)用。這里選擇何種分配方案,將涉及不同的運(yùn)輸費(fèi)用,所以其是一個典型的線性規(guī)劃問題,同時也是一個總產(chǎn)量大于總銷量的產(chǎn)銷不平衡運(yùn)輸問題。根據(jù)題目已知可以得出以下圖論:新普隆宇恒華北京天津廣東上海模型建立:假設(shè)某物品有m個產(chǎn)地 a1、a2、 am,各產(chǎn)地的產(chǎn)量是a1、a2、am;有n個銷地b1、b2、bn,各銷售地銷量分別為b1、b2、bn;假定從產(chǎn)地ai(i=1,2,m)向銷售地bj(j=1,2,n)運(yùn)價單位物品的運(yùn)價是cij,問這樣調(diào)運(yùn)這些物

4、品才能使運(yùn)費(fèi)最少? 設(shè) xij 為從產(chǎn)地ai運(yùn)往銷地bj的運(yùn)輸量,若各產(chǎn)地產(chǎn)量之和大于各銷地銷量之和,即有:則得到下列產(chǎn)銷平衡運(yùn)輸量問題的模型:其中,約束條件右側(cè)常數(shù)ai和bj,約束條件最多有m+n-1個有效,即最多有m+n-1個基可行解。為了能使用表上作業(yè)法,可增加一個假想的銷地虛銷地bn+1而由產(chǎn)地ai(i=1,2,m)調(diào)運(yùn)到這個假想銷地的物品數(shù)量的銷量xi,n+1(相當(dāng)于松弛變量),實(shí)際上就地儲存在ai。因為就地儲存沒有運(yùn)輸,故單價為ci,n+1=0,(i=1,2,m)令假想銷地的銷量為:從而數(shù)學(xué)模型: 基本假設(shè):針對該運(yùn)輸問題,為了方便計算,可以設(shè)新普(a1),隆宇(a2)和恒華(a3

5、)分別銷往北京(b1)、天津(b2)、廣東(b3)和上海(b4)四個城市銷售量為x11、x12、x13、x14、x21、x22、x23、x24、x31、x32、x33、x34。建立以下模型:表:1-2b1b2b3b4產(chǎn)量a1626730a2495325a3881521銷量15172212-目標(biāo)(the objective)最少費(fèi)用:約束條件:供應(yīng)限制(the supply constrains)指標(biāo)約束(the damand constrains)定義符號說明:a1、a2、a3分別代表新普,隆宇和恒華生產(chǎn)商;b1、b2、b3、b4分別代表北京,天津,廣東,上海銷售地。x11、x12、x13、x

6、14、x21、x22、x23、x24、x31、x32、x33、x34為新普、隆宇和恒華分別銷往北京、天津、廣東和上海四個城市銷售量。cij為從產(chǎn)地ai(i=1,2,m)向銷售地bj(j=1,2,n)運(yùn)價單位物品的運(yùn)價, xij 為從產(chǎn)地ai(i=1,2,m)運(yùn)往銷地bj(j=1,2,n)的運(yùn)輸量。z即為整個運(yùn)輸過程中涉及的運(yùn)輸費(fèi)用。min z則為該運(yùn)輸問題中的最小費(fèi)用。表上作業(yè)法(最小元素法):最小元素法:是找出運(yùn)價表中最小的元素,然后在運(yùn)量表內(nèi)對應(yīng)的格填入允許取得的最大數(shù)值,若某行或者某列的產(chǎn)量或者銷量已得到滿足,則把運(yùn)價表中該運(yùn)價所在行或者列劃去;找出未劃去的運(yùn)價中的最小數(shù)值,按此辦法依次

7、進(jìn)行下去,直至得到一個基本可行解的方法。表上作業(yè)法:是求解運(yùn)輸問題的一種簡便而有效的方法,求解過程在運(yùn)輸表上進(jìn)行行,這是一種迭代求解法,迭代步驟為:步驟一:按某種規(guī)則找出一個初始基可行解。步驟二:對進(jìn)行解作最有判斷,即求個非基變量的檢驗數(shù),判別是否達(dá)到最優(yōu)解。如果已經(jīng)是最優(yōu)解,則停止計算;如果不是最優(yōu)解,則進(jìn)行下一步驟。步驟三:在表上對初始方案進(jìn)行改進(jìn),找出新的基可行解,再按照步驟二進(jìn)行判別,直至找出最優(yōu)解。表上作業(yè)法具體求解如下:表:1-3:-12221715銷量21501218080a3253125090413a217230706126a1產(chǎn)量b4b3b2b1步驟一:從表1-2中找出最小運(yùn)

8、價為1,故首先考慮此項,由于a3產(chǎn)地產(chǎn)量小于b3銷量(2117),故在表1-3的(a1,b2)交叉格填上17,由于b2銷量已經(jīng)飽和,故劃去表1-4中的b2列得表1-5。表:1-5b1b3b4a1667a2453步驟三:從表1-5中找出最小運(yùn)價為3,故首先考慮此項,由于a2產(chǎn)地產(chǎn)量大于b4銷量(2512),故在表1-3的(a2,b4)交叉格填上12,由于b4銷量已經(jīng)飽和,故劃去表1-5中的b2列得表1-6。表:1-6b1b3a166a245步驟四:從表1-6中找出最小運(yùn)價為4,故首先考慮此項,由于a2產(chǎn)地剩余產(chǎn)量小于b1銷量(25-12=1315-13=2),故在表1-3的(a1,b1)交叉格填

9、上2,由于b1銷量已經(jīng)飽和,故劃去表1-5中的b2列。步驟六:由于b3銷地為達(dá)到飽和,故在(a1,b3)交叉格填上1,然后在其它空格位置統(tǒng)一填上0。經(jīng)以上步驟得到一個總產(chǎn)量大于總銷量,且銷量全部滿足的調(diào)配方案。經(jīng)過計算,空格的檢驗數(shù)均大于零,最優(yōu)方案為:最小費(fèi)用為:lingo求解模型:lingo模型:model:sets:origin/1.3/:a;sale/1.4/:b;routes(origin,sale):c,x;endsetsdata:a=30,25,21;b=15,17,22,12;c=6,2,6,7,4,9,5,3,8,8,1,5;enddataobjmin=sum(routes:

10、c*x);for(origin(i):supsum(sale(j):x(i,j)=a(i);for(sale(j):demsum(origin(i):x(i,j)=b(j);endlingo結(jié)果: global optimal solution found. objective value: 161.0000 infeasibilities: 0.000000 total solver iterations: 6 variable value reduced cost x( 1, 1) 2.000000 0.000000 x( 1, 2) 17.00000 0.000000 x( 1, 3)

11、1.000000 0.000000 x( 1, 4) 0.000000 2.000000 x( 2, 1) 13.00000 0.000000 x( 2, 2) 0.000000 9.000000 x( 2, 3) 0.000000 1.000000 x( 2, 4) 12.00000 0.000000 x( 3, 1) 0.000000 7.000000 x( 3, 2) 0.000000 11.00000 x( 3, 3) 21.00000 0.000000 x( 3, 4) 0.000000 5.000000 row slack or surplus dual price obj 161

12、.0000 -1.000000 sup( 1) 10.00000 0.000000 sup( 2) 0.000000 2.000000 sup( 3) 0.000000 5.000000 dem( 1) 0.000000 -6.000000 dem( 2) 0.000000 -2.000000 dem( 3) 0.000000 -6.000000 dem( 4) 0.000000 -5.000000結(jié)果分析:從計算結(jié)果可以得出,新普(a1)分別銷往北京(b1)、天津(b2)、廣東(b3)和上海(b4)四個城市銷售量為分別為2萬臺,17萬臺,1萬臺,0萬臺,剩余10萬臺;隆宇(a2)分別銷往北京

13、(b1)、天津(b2)、廣東(b3)和上海(b4)四個城市銷售量為別為13萬臺,0萬臺,0萬臺,12萬臺,剩余0萬臺;恒華(a3)分別銷往北京(b1)、天津(b2)、廣東(b3)和上海(b4)四個城市銷售量為分別為0萬臺,0萬臺,21萬臺,0萬臺,剩余0萬臺;總費(fèi)用為161個單位。通過兩個求解法最終得出的結(jié)果加以比較分析,無論是表上作業(yè)法還是lingo軟件求解法,求解出來的結(jié)果都是相同的,在顯示最小運(yùn)輸費(fèi)用外,都還能看出分別運(yùn)輸分配量,這充分說明了lingo軟件在實(shí)際工作中的可行性??偨Y(jié):運(yùn)輸問題是日常生活中經(jīng)常涉及的問題,這種線性規(guī)劃問題他牽涉到某些物品由一個空間位置轉(zhuǎn)移到另一個空間位置,其就產(chǎn)生了運(yùn)輸。掌握運(yùn)輸問題的模型以及求解方法,這對解決諸

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論